Central Intelligence Agency Director Porter Goss and several officials and members of Congress spoke at the opening of the Center for Advanced Study of Language at the University of Maryland, College Park. Mr. Goss talked about the importance of language in the intelligence community and the value of clear communications in national security fields. close
